Transaction 3745bf70f31903aff6325e7fe1d6f695ccb02b9524f5fe5db0e6c2ea2351b9b4

1 Input
2 Outputs
  • 3745bf70f31903aff6325e7fe1d6f695ccb02b9524f5fe5db0e6c2ea2351b9b4:0
  • value  388635771
    address  3KPuP4tT6KLv9sT3TuETd5jnpH3M644qvM
  • 3745bf70f31903aff6325e7fe1d6f695ccb02b9524f5fe5db0e6c2ea2351b9b4:1
  • value  500000
    address  1XRW5gL577qtShPRaPXpByNocNriPzDRG